Abstract
												⺠A thin hydrogenated surface disorder layer on crystalline TiO2 electrode induces larger capacity. ⺠It induces higher Coulombic efficiency, better rate performance, and longer stability. ⺠It facilitates transport and alleviates structural distortion in the electrode. ⺠The fast ion exchange rate may play a role in the hydrogenated disordered layer.
